The whole CEO concern I think is not such a big deal as we make it out to be. We are perhaps a bit too influenced by what we have seen in other startups. If Bisq has a clear **mission**, priorities can just as easily be set by a small group as by a CEO. You can have a structure like this:

0. DAO                                       --> votes on compensation and important decisions
1. Team Leads (5-10)                 --> collegiate decisions on priorities, individual direction of regular work
2. Regular contributors (10-50) --> work under team leads
3. Occasional contributors (100) --> join projects under team leads or work for bounties
4. Market makers, power users (1000) --> have their own business models within Bisq but are fully independent
5. Users (10.000-100.000) --> Use Bisq. Can participate in DAO.
